Where are the best suits in the world made?

Generally the best suits are considered to come from Paris, Napoli and London. Parisian makers tends to have more handwork, Neapolitan have a more relaxed style and London's Savile Row has variety and flexibility.

What makes a high quality suit?

The second of the signs of a good quality suit is the fabric used to make the suit. Quality suits will be made using natural materials which is most commonly wool as well as cotton, linen and silk. Higher thread counts such as super 120's and 130's produce a lighter, softer and more comfortable suit.

Are expensive suits worth it?

The cut of a $100 suit can, in theory, be as good as the on of a $1000 suit or a more expensive suit but in practice, that's rarely the case. For a $100 suit, this pattern is the same for everyone without any custom element and so it will never fit you perfectly.

What suit should I buy?

The style should be plain and flexible: single-breasted, 2-3 buttons, with a classic fit. The fabric should be a fine, lightweight wool, so that you can wear it in every season of the year. A charcoal gray suit matches well with a wide variety of other colors, making choosing your dress shirt and tie a breeze.
